面向对象程序设计语言的三大原则
1、(一)封装封装是类将内部数据隐藏。
2、封装为用户提供对象的属性和行为的接口,用户通过这些接口使用这些类,无虔銎哂埽须知道这些类内部是如何构成的,同时用户不能操作类中的内部数据。
3、(二)继承首先,我们定义一个父类,本例为动物。
4、图片中的向下箭头,表示本级目录对下级目录子类。
5、接着,在父类下又可分为爬行动物、鸟类、哺乳动物等子类。
6、其中,向上的箭头表示本级目录对上级目录父类。
7、每个子类下又可以有子类,中间层的子类成为下一层的父类,每个子类继承父类的属性和方法。
8、(三)多态将父类对拇峨镅贪象应用于子类的特征就是多态,每一个父类下都可以继承子类,如果将子类对象统一看作是父类的实例对象,子类都调用了父类的属性和方法,但又与父类不相同。
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
阅读量:64
阅读量:87
阅读量:93
阅读量:44
阅读量:34